The timing of the FAA’s emergency airworthiness directive (AD) addressing possible corrosion in tail assemblies of de Havilland Canada DHC–3 Otters is under scrutiny from industry leaders.

The FAA released the emergency AD last week. Transport Canada issued a similar AD more than four years ago. AD CF-2018-04 was issued by Transport Canada on January 19, 2018, in response to corrosion found on DHC-3 tail assemblies. The AD established a requirement for inspecting the aircraft’s elevators for corrosion, which can lead to structural failure and result in an uncommanded nose-down pitch moment.

Last month, a deHavilland DHC-3 Turbine Otter operated by Northwest Seaplanes went down in Mutiny Bay off Whidbey Island in Washington. According to witnesses, the aircraft was flying at an altitude of approximately 600 feet above the surface when it suddenly plunged into the water, killing all 10 people on board
.

Strategic Petroleum Reserve

A president can release oil from the SPR to try to lower the price of crude oil, but that oil has to be refined. Even if the price of crude plummeted, if there isn't the capability to refine it, the prices of gasoline, diesel fuel, jet fuel and home heating oil will not drop accordingly.

Refineries have been closing, primarily due to the pandemic. And with EVs becoming more numerous, the incentive to build new refineries (or reopen closed ones) isn't exactly strong.

Russian Resupply

The Russians are facing increasing problems in supplying their forces in Ukraine because of a shortage of railroad freight cars.

The Russian rail system is being starved of rolling stock because of a shortage of roller bearings for their axles. Some 10,000 railway cars were pulled offline because of a bearing shortage in August with another 20,000 expected to be sidelined in the next two months. Repair facilities are unable to repair them because of the shortage. This represents about 20-30% of Russian rail cars of all types.

It's more than roller bearings.

Components were brought from abroad, and only the final assembly [of railcars] was carried out at Russian enterprises. Now there is nothing to assemble them from and nothing to replace imports with. They need sealants and lubricants, which are produced neither in Russia nor the CIS.

In the aftermath of Hurricane Ian, first responders in Southwest Florida are concerned about a new threat: electric vehicles catching on fire caused by saltwater.

Not only did the massive storm cause destruction of buildings, schools, and homes on the coast; it also resulted in major saltwater flooding.

Damaged EVs that have been submerged in saltwater “could result in potential fire once no longer submerged,” according to an alert posted on Facebook this week by the North Collier Fire Control and Rescue District.

Firefighters in Naples have responded to at least six electric vehicles that caught fire and are asking EV owners in the area “to please get it towed away from your home BUT you must make sure the towing operator knows how to safely and properly tow EV vehicles,” according to the Facebook post.

Maybe take those EVs to a freshwater lake, push them in for awhile to dilute the salt, pull the doors, hood and trunk covers off, then drop them into open-top shipping containers full of rice for a week or so?

Apparently, even if one catches on fire and the firefighters put it out, it can reignite days later.

This is kinda sorta of how the matches are scored: You shoot a stage and get a raw time. If you hit the A-zone, every time, that's the time for your stage. If you hit the C-zone, a second is added for that. If you hit the D-zone, two seconds are added. A miss is five seconds. If you hit a no-shoot target, that's a five second penalty (plus the five-second penalty for missing, unless you made that up with an additional round). If you don't shoot at a target at all, you get hit with a penalty for that, plus two misses. (It's actually much more complicated with that.)

Which means that there is a point where, if you're halfway accurate, speed trumps accuracy.
